Archivists Salary in Bridgeport, CT (2024)

Source: BLS OEWS May 2024 · Bridgeport-Stamford-Danbury, CT · 50 employed

The average Archivists salary in Bridgeport, CT is $67,250 per year. The middle 50% of Archivistss earn between $49,950 and $72,570. Top earners in the 90th percentile make $101,650 or more. Entry-level positions typically start around $32,640. The median of $59,260 is above the mean, reflecting the wage distribution in this field.

Archivists Salary Breakdown in Bridgeport, CT

Percentile Annual Salary
10th Percentile (Entry-level) $32,640
25th Percentile $49,950
Median (50th Percentile) $59,260
Mean (Average) $67,250
75th Percentile $72,570
90th Percentile (Top earners) $101,650
